Columbia University – where pro-Palestinian students calling for an end to the war in Gaza have been setting up a tented demonstration for more than a week – has announced that it has banned one of the protest leaders, Khymani James, from entering the campus , who declared in a video in January that “Zionists do not deserve to live.” In announcing the decision to exclude the student from campus, the university did not clarify whether the boy had been permanently suspended or expelled.

James had made the controversial comments during and after a disciplinary hearing with Columbia administrators, which he recorded and later posted on Instagram. The hearing, held earlier this year, focused on an earlier comment he had shared on social media, in which he said, among other things, that “Zionists are white supremacists and Nazis.” «All this is the antithesis of peace. And so, yes, I feel very comfortable, very comfortable, asking for these people to die,” the student noted in the video.

Yesterday, James admitted on social media that what he had said “was wrong”. “Every member of our community deserves to feel safe”, the phrase with which he tried to remedy this, specifying that he had made these comments in January before being involved in the protest movement currently taking place on campus. For their part, other pro-Palestinian student groups have noted, according to the New York Times, that one student’s statements do not reflect the movement as a whole.
